About Mariano & Paula

Both Mariano and Paula have extensive experience of not only tango but also with Folklore, classical dance, contemporary to circus.  Their dancing style is elegant yet dynamic and their musicality is exceptional.  Their milonga performance is specially outstanding.   Check it out on Youtube. They have taught in Universidad del tango in Buenos Aires as well as many tango festivals in Europe such as Warshaw, Leipzig and in Spain.  Recently they were invited to teach at the October Tango Festival in Portland and have been touring in the USA.  In New York they recently performed in a show “Tangueros del Sur” directed by Natalia Hills and Gabriel Misse.
